Touring cycling around Les Cammazes offers diverse landscapes at the foot of the Montagne Noire, providing varied terrain for cyclists. The region features dense forests of beech, oak, and chestnut, along with significant waterways like the Canal du Midi and the Rigole de la Montagne Noire. Lakes such as Lac de Saint-Ferréol, Lake Cammazes, and Lake Lampy contribute to the scenic environment. There are 45 touring cycling routes available around Les Cammazes. These routes offer a range of experiences, from moderate lakeside paths to more challenging forest trails with significant elevation changes.
You can expect a diverse range of terrain. Routes often feature gentle lakeside paths, shaded forest trails through dense beech, oak, and chestnut trees, and paths alongside historical waterways like the Rigole de la Montagne Noire. Some sections, particularly along the Canal du Midi, may be unpaved and stony, making mountain bikes or electric all-terrain bikes suitable for those parts.
Yes, the region offers routes suitable for families. The paths around Lac de Saint-Ferréol, for instance, are relatively flat and pleasant, ideal for all skill levels. While specific 'easy' routes are 5 out of 45, many moderate routes can be enjoyed by families looking for a slightly longer ride.
Many routes pass by significant natural and historical features. You can explore the impressive Rigole of the Montagne Noire, a historic canal, or the engineering marvel of the Vauban Vault. The scenic lakes, such as Lac des Cammazes and Lac de Saint-Ferréol, are central to many routes and offer beautiful views.
Yes, many touring cycling routes in Les Cammazes are circular. For example, the Lac des Cammazes – Vauban Vault loop from Les Cammazes is a popular 20.1 km circular route. Another option is the Lampy – Sentier de la prise d'Alzeau loop from Plage du Lampy, which is 24.9 km.
The region is generally pleasant for cycling from spring through autumn. The Montagne Noire provides shaded paths, which can be particularly welcome during warmer months. The varied landscapes, from forests to lakesides, offer beautiful scenery throughout these seasons.
The routes vary in difficulty. Out of 45 routes, 5 are rated easy, 13 are moderate, and 27 are difficult. You can find gentle lakeside paths for relaxed rides, but also more challenging routes with significant elevation changes, especially in the foothills of the Montagne Noire. For instance, the Revel – Lac de Saint-Ferréol loop from Saissac is a difficult 54.6 km route with over 950 meters of elevation gain.
Many routes start from villages or popular lake areas like Les Cammazes or Plage du Lampy, where parking facilities are generally available. For example, routes like the Lac des Cammazes – Vauban Vault loop typically begin from Les Cammazes itself, offering convenient starting points.
The touring cycling routes around Les Cammazes are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.4 stars from over 60 reviews. Cyclists often praise the diverse landscapes, the historical waterways, and the scenic lake views that define the area.
Yes, experienced riders will find several longer and more challenging options. The Roc Lock – Grand Bassin in Castelnaudary loop from Les Cammazes is a difficult 86 km route. Another challenging option is the Lake Galaube – Lake Laprade loop from Arfons, which covers 42.8 km with over 800 meters of elevation gain.
Absolutely. The region is rich in historical waterways. Many routes follow the Rigole de la Montagne Noire, which is part of the water supply system for the Canal du Midi. You can also find sections along the Canal du Midi itself, offering a unique historical and natural cycling experience.
Yes, the lakes are a central feature of many touring cycling routes. You can find routes that circle Lac des Cammazes or explore the area around Lac de Saint-Ferréol. The Lampy – Sentier de la prise d'Alzeau loop from Plage du Lampy, for instance, winds around Lake Lampy.
